Felipe Calderón, the business-friendly candidate won in Mexico
Media Release
Jul. 3, 2006

 

Felipe Calderón, the business-friendly candidate of the ruling National Action Party, emerged as the most likely winner of one of the closest elections in Mexico’s history.
